Abstract

Learning is basically a condition that makes learners to learn. Teachers as learning subjects are required to master various learning models in accordance with the material and student learning needs. The rapid development of the era marked by the industrial revolution that continues to advance, from the 1.0 era to the present which is recognized as being in the 4.0 era, certainly has an impact on the world of education. The demands of high quality education can be achieved, one of which is by transforming the learning model which slowly begins to shift following the direction of the times. The purpose of this study is to recommend relevant learning models to be implemented in the 4.0 era. The method used in this study is literature review with a descriptive qualitative approach, which takes data through documentation studies (literature). The result of this study is information that currently it can be said to be in the 4.0 era with several indicators in various industrial sectors ranging from FMCG, electronics, textiles, automotive, electronics, to financial and banking services.
